Analysis
In 2024, diphtheria - number of reported cases, annual growth rate in Thailand stood at 150 % change on previous year.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 566.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, diphtheria - number of reported cases, annual growth rate in Thailand peaked at 541.67 % change on previous year in 2010 and was at its lowest, -92.31 % change on previous year, in 2005.
Thailand ranks 14th of 140 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Diphtheria - number of reported cases.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Diphtheria - number of reported cases World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
